LAHORE, Aug 13: The Pakistan juniors team will take part in the six-nation Singapore International Challenge hockey tournament, which will be staged in Singapore from Oct 17 to 21.
Besides Pakistan and hosts Singapore, the other participating countries are Malaysia, Australia, Hong Kong and India. The competition for women will also run side-by-side the men. In women section, Malaysia, Australia, Hong Kong and Singapore are the participants.
According to draw, Pakistan will play their first match against Hong Kong on Oct 18.
The teams have been divided in two pools wherein the top two teams from each pool will play the final on Oct 21.
Groups:
Pool A: Australia, Malaysia, Singapore.
Pool B: Pakistan, India, Hong Kong.
Schedule:
Oct 17: India v Hong Kong; Singapore v Australia.
Oct 18: Pakistan v Hong Kong; Malaysia v Australia.
